Conjugate librar in Spanish

to free / to wage

librar is a regular -ar verb ranked #2218 among the most common Spanish verbs. For example: "Libraron una batalla épica." (They waged an epic battle.). Use the tables below for full conjugation across all 7 tenses.

Describes current actions, habits, and general truths. The most frequently used tense — master it first.

Pronoun Conjugation
yo libro
libras
él/ella/Ud. libra
nosotros libramos
vosotros libráis
ellos/ellas/Uds. libran
Example

Yo libro todos los días.

I free / to wage every day.

Describes completed past actions with a clear start and end. Key signals: ayer, el lunes pasado, de repente.

Pronoun Conjugation
yo libré
libraste
él/ella/Ud. libró
nosotros libramos
vosotros librasteis
ellos/ellas/Uds. libraron
Example

Libraron una batalla épica.

They waged an epic battle.

Describes habitual past actions, background context, and ongoing states. Key signals: siempre, normalmente, cuando era niño.

Pronoun Conjugation
yo libraba
librabas
él/ella/Ud. libraba
nosotros librábamos
vosotros librabais
ellos/ellas/Uds. libraban
